Worth noting that there's actually minimal evidence that private schools actually result in better outcomes. Much of the differences can be explained simply by the SES of the children regardless of where they attend i.e.https://www.theage.com.au/education/fourth-study-this-year-confirms-private-schools-no-better-than-public-20141110-11jlgn.html …
